tracking wide off drag line
I have a 5 month old bluetick that tracks way off to the side of the drag. He runs that tell the trail turns then he comes back to the trail re groups and continues off the trail and to the tree with the drag in it. Is there a problem down to road with his way of tracking.
sounds to me that he is winding the track, there is nothing wrong with it as long as he picks the right tree.

How much Scent are you using on the Drag ???
It only takes a few Drops on each side ..
Too Much Scent creates a Very wide and blowing trail ..

I frequently hunt in winter with snow on the ground. My dogs run a few yards down wind of tracks quite often.
In fact, I prefer a heads up drifting track running to catch hound over the dogs that stay on line.
